Details of modified 2005 Audi A4

– Will the wheels 18x8.5 12 offset with P 215/35 R18 tires fit on a 2005 Audi A4?

– Yes, they will fit. As you can see from the pics this 2005 Audi A4 is running Impul Dish 18x8.5 with 5.22” backspacing and Nankang NS-2 P 215/35 R18 tires.

- Front offset +40mm plus 28mm adapter = +12mm eff. offset
- Rear offset +40mm plus 20mm adapter = +20mm eff. offset
- Unmodified fenders
- Rear camber at max negative with stock camber bolt
- BC Racing coilovers
- Stock brakes

Definitions

Wheel Offset

Refers to how your car’s or truck’s wheels and tires are mounted and sit in the wheel wells.

– Zero wheel offset is when the hub mounting surface is in line with the centerline of the wheel.
– Positive wheel offset is when the hub mounting surface is in front (more toward the street side) of the centerline of the wheel. Most wheels on front-wheel drive cars and newer rear-drive vehicles have positive offset.
– Negative offset is when the hub mounting surface is behind the wheel centerline. “Deep dish” wheels are typically a negative offset.
